There’s also increasing evidence supporting the anti-cancer and antitumor properties of thymosin alpha 1:
1. By regulating cytokine secretion and repairing damaged immune system, thymosin alpha 1 may help reduce cancer incidence. [14]
2. In stage IV human breast cancer model, thymosin alpha 1 treatment was associated with significantly slow tumor growth. [15]
3. In patients with metastatic melanoma and advanced non-small cell lung cancer, thymosin alpha 1 treatment prolonged survival. [16]
4. In patients with hepatitis B virus-associated liver cancer, thymosin alpha 1 therapy improved liver function and significantly prolonged recurrence‑free and overall survival. [17]
5. Thymosin alpha 1 exerts its anti-tumor effects mainly by increasing the secretion of various T cell lymphokines, activating T4 helper cells to promote lymphocyte activity, and increasing the cytotoxicity of natural killer cells. [18-20]
6. Administration of thymosin alpha 1 in cancer patients was associated with reduced risk of dying and improved disease‐/progression‐free survival. [21]
7. In patients with metastatic lung cancer, thymosin alpha 1 treatment was associated with complete disappearance of lesions. [22]
8. A cell study found that exposure of human breast cancer cells to thymosin alpha 1 induced apoptosis (programmed cell death). [23]
9. Administration of thymosin alpha 1 in cancer patients increased the anti-tumor effect of chemotherapy while markedly reducing side effects of the treatment. [24]
10. In tumor-bearing mice, thymosin alpha 1 significantly delayed tumor growth and prolonged survival time. [25]
